IBOT
Mark Identification

IBOT

Serial Number

86888356

Filing Date

Jan 27, 2016

Registration Date

Oct 15, 2019

Trademark by

DEKA RESEARCH & DEVELOPMENT CORP.

Active Trademark

Classification Information

Motorized, electric-powered, self-propelled, self-balancing, wheeled personal mobility, transportation device

Vehicles